With Ministry as a Service (MaaS), governments can move beyond pilot projects and put artificial intelligence (AI) at the very core of service delivery – faster, cheaper and more citizen-centric.

As governance adopts AI across all its fields, the heart of AI Economics, a core Whiteshield concept, becomes inextricably linked with the notion of AI value and the measurement of resource use: the link between the AI computer power that provides shared services to citizens.

In every technology wave – from PCs to the internet, cloud and now AI – the private sector has adapted faster than governments. But this time, governments can’t afford to fall behind.
